One of the best ways to have high quality sleep is to lie down on a comfortable bed. Certainly, certain types of beds and mattresses can help in improving one’s sleep. People who have problems like back pain, insomnia, muscle pain, numbness and restlessness would do well to choose a bed that goes the extra mile in helping them sleep well.

A foam bed wedge will help out in this regard, and it’s the very reason that this product is so popular.  A foam wedge for bed is made up of density materials with single detached cells. These types of pillows relax your muscles, as well as other parts of your body. They can easily mold to the structure and position of one’s body and this plays a great role in reducing pain and improving sleep.

Foam bed wedges are comprised of high thickness foam and do not consist of any coils or springs.   Because of this, a foam bed wedge distributes body weight effectively relieves and eases pressure points.  They have the unique ability to reduce the pressure produced by your body weight that may generally lead to persistent pain.  In effect, this increases the flow of blood throughout your body and allows you to get a better night’s sleep.  Doctors will echo these remarks, often recommending them to their patients.

Bed wedges made of foam are strong enough to give ample support, but at the same time they’re soft enough to be totally comfortable. Whether someone  sleeps on his side, stomach, or back,  the wedge will accommodate the user’s sleep position without any issues.  A memory foam bed wedge (like those made by Sarah Peyton) is even more unique in the sense that it remembers your typical sleep positions and molds to the shape of your body, making things all the more comfortable as you sleep.

The versatility of a foam bed wedge makes it useful a huge number of reasons. It doesn’t only need to be used during times of sleep.  You can use one while sitting up in bed, or you could simply rest your feet on a foam bed rest pillow to allow the blood to flow from your legs through the rest of your body.

As a result, foam bed wedges are particularly useful in helping people with conditions like acid reflux, hiatal hernias, and swollen feet, all due to the angling at which things take place. If you’re looking to buy a foam bed wedge, there are plenty of great places to look online.  You’ll be happy to know that they’re very reasonably priced too.  The most important thing that you’ll want to pay attention to is the measurements of the bed wedge (usually measured in inches).  This will determine the angle at which you sleep and a doctor may be able to advise you with regards to the best height and length of your wedge.  You’ll also want to know how many bed wedges come per order, as it’s not at all uncommon to see packs of two or four sold at once.

As far as pricing goes, $30 or so should be more than enough to find a great foam bed wedge, and some online comparison shopping will validate this.
